The sump doesn't have to come right off the car. Just drop the oil, take all the bolts out and let it sit on the crossmember. The hardest part will be getting the crank pulley off. The tensioner sits down near the sump and is pretty easy to change - only a couple of 12mm bolts from memory. The plunger is the rod that comes out of the tensioner and acts on the chain.
